I have a 92 F-150 2WD that will be used as a ranch truck. It currently has P23575R15 tires on it that are well worn. I want to replace these w/ something a little bigger, more aggressive, etc. The truck will be used primarly off of the main roads on dirt, etc. It will be carrying allot of weight in the bed in the form of a 200gallon water tank.

I was looking at the BFGoodrich A/T 31x10.5 Load Range C tires. They are $100/tire at Discount Tire and I can get $50 back on a set of 4.

You are 2WD, he is 4WD, but it's pertinent nonetheless. Basically, the same rules apply to your truck. You probably have the 6.5" wheels...the 31x10.50 will work if you have a decent gap of clearance between the suspension and the inside edge of the current tire, about 1"-1.25" gap with the 235 you have now and any suspension components.
